上面是摘自圖論書上的定義。 算法在運行過程中刪除了所有已走的路徑,也就是說途中殘留了所有沒有行走的邊。根據割邊的定義,如果在搜索過程中遇到割邊意味着當前的搜索路徑需要改進,即提前輸出某一個聯通子集的訪問序列,這樣就能夠保證訪問完其中聯通子圖中后再通過割邊訪問后一個聯通子圖,最后再沿原路輸出 ...
hiho歐拉路 二 分析: 小Ho:這種簡單的謎題就交給我吧 小Hi:真的沒問題么 lt 分鍾過去 gt 小Ho:啊啊啊啊啊 搞不定啊 骨牌數量一多就亂了。 小Hi:哎,我就知道你會遇到問題。 小Ho:小Hi快來幫幫我 小Hi:好了,好了。讓我們一起來解決這個問題。 lt 小Hi思考了一下 gt 小Hi:原來是這樣。。。小Ho你仔細觀察這個例子: 因為相連的兩個數字總是相同的,不妨我們只寫一次, ...
2015-06-17 19:28 1 4665 推薦指數:
上面是摘自圖論書上的定義。 算法在運行過程中刪除了所有已走的路徑,也就是說途中殘留了所有沒有行走的邊。根據割邊的定義,如果在搜索過程中遇到割邊意味着當前的搜索路徑需要改進,即提前輸出某一個聯通子集的訪問序列,這樣就能夠保證訪問完其中聯通子圖中后再通過割邊訪問后一個聯通子圖,最后再沿原路輸出 ...
在數論,對正整數n,歐拉函數是少於或等於n的數中與n互質的數的數目。此函數以其首名研究者歐拉命名,它又稱為Euler's totient function、φ函數、歐拉商數等。 例如φ(8)=4,因為1,3,5,7均和8互質。 從歐拉函數引伸出來在環論方面的事實和拉格朗日定理構成了歐拉定理 ...
1.【定義】 歐拉路我們將其稱為是一個圖中從某一節點 \(S\) 出發,恰好經過圖中每條邊各一次,但是可以重復經過圖中節點的路。 歐拉回路就是指就是從某點 \(S\) 出發最后仍回到 \(S\) 的歐拉路。 存在歐拉路的圖被稱為歐拉圖。 存在歐拉路但是不存在歐拉回路的圖叫做半歐拉圖 ...
發現這個小東西雖然很簡單但是考一次掛一次 A.定義 歐拉路:圖中任意一個點開始到圖中任意一個點結束,且通過的每條邊只被通過一次的路徑。 歐拉回路:同上,不過起點與終點相同。 B.判定 這里只以歐拉路為例。 無向圖:對於一張無向圖,當且僅當圖聯通且奇點數為0或2時,存在一條能遍歷整 ...
歐拉篩法求素數 首先,我們知道當一個數為素數的時候,它的倍數肯定不是素數。所以我們可以從2開始通過乘積篩掉所有的合數。 將所有合數標記,保證不被重復篩除,時間復雜度為O(n)。代碼比較簡單↓_↓ if(i % prime[j] == 0) break;←_←這一步 ...
一、基本概念: 歐拉路:歐拉路是指從圖中任意一個點開始到圖中任意一個點結束的路徑,並且圖中每條邊通過的且只通過一次。 歐拉回路:歐拉回路是指起點和終點相同的歐拉路。 二、存在歐拉路的條件: 1.無向連通圖存在歐拉路的條件: 所有點度都是偶數,或者恰好有兩個點度是奇數,則有歐拉路 ...
如果 無向圖有兩個奇數度結點,則僅有歐拉通路,是半歐拉圖 此外,則該無向圖既不是 ...
歐拉回路放了好久,一直以來就認為他就是判定+dfs,但總有個Fleury壓在心頭,今天仔細一看,不就是dfs嗎?還弄個人名做外套。 Fleury算法: 1.判定該圖是否為Euler圖,包括有向歐拉通路,有向歐拉回路,無向歐拉通路,無向歐拉回路: 有向歐拉通路:起點:出度-入度=1,終點:入度 ...